Round numbers are supporting context
Round-number levels are best used as simple psychological reference points, not as magical stand-alone zones. Their real value comes from showing where many traders are likely to pay attention.
They matter more when they overlap
A round number becomes more useful when it lines up with a session high, pivot, VWAP interaction, or obvious structure edge. The overlap gives the level more practical weight.
Use a sensible interval for the instrument
The interval that works on one market can be useless on another. The goal is to choose spacing that feels natural for the instrument instead of cluttering the chart with unnecessary lines.
